Is it likely that cryptocurrencies will see a decrease in value again?
With the recent volatility in the cryptocurrency market, many investors are wondering if there will be another decrease in the value of cryptocurrencies. What are the factors that could contribute to a potential decrease in value?
3 answers
- omegaNov 24, 2025 · 5 months agoIt's difficult to predict the future value of cryptocurrencies with certainty. However, there are several factors that could potentially lead to a decrease in their value. One factor is market sentiment. If there is a widespread belief that cryptocurrencies are overvalued or if there is negative news surrounding the industry, it could lead to a decrease in demand and ultimately a decrease in value. Additionally, regulatory actions by governments around the world could also impact the value of cryptocurrencies. If governments impose stricter regulations or ban cryptocurrencies altogether, it could negatively affect their value. Lastly, market manipulation and speculation can also contribute to sudden decreases in value. Overall, while it's impossible to say for certain, these factors should be considered when assessing the likelihood of a decrease in cryptocurrency value.
